Poser

So I’m sitting at an airport gate wearing a Montreal Canadiens t-shirt because I ran out of clothes on the road, and it was $7 at Walmart. Well, they’re apparently in the Stanley Cup conference finals this year and the guy sitting next to me is a huge Canadiens fan. He saw my shirt and started yapping to me about the team and last night’s game… And instead of just telling him I know nothing about the team or the sport, I for some reason, try to get thru the conversation without getting found out. Why? Your guess is as good as mine.

“Can you believe that OT goal last nite?” he asked me. And because I didn’t know whether the goal he was talking about was good or bad for “our” team I just shook my head and replied, “Psssshhh.”
If I spoke to someone wearing Eagles swag and they told me it didn’t mean anything to them, I’d probably go on a rant about how they could have bought almost any other t-shirt besides that one and how you shouldn’t represent for something if you don’t believe it… I eventually just put on my headphones and closed my eyes to end the convo. But the point here is that I’m a hypocrite and a poser. I know and accept it.

Hey guys! Last Comic Standing is back for season 8 and guess who’s gonna be on it…? That’s right, Roseanne Barr and Keenen Ivory Wayans. And also, me. The show premieres May 22 at 9pm on NBC and If you watch the clip below very slowly you can see me for about a millisecond. My very first TV appearance was on this show in 2008. I did pretty well, but I hated the cameras and competing against friends and… I swore I’d never do it again. But then I found out this season is being produced by my faves, Wanda Sykes and Page Hurwitz, and that it was by invite only and that the comics will compete in several comedy disciplines (stand-up, improv and sketch) and so I decided to give it another go. I don’t know yet which night I’ll be appearing so tune in starting this Thursday and to see how far I get!
